National Institute for Drug Abuse

The U.S. National Institute on Drug Abuse, or NIDA, is a federal agency committed to understanding and addressing the complexities of drug abuse and addiction. Through extensive research, public education initiatives, and treatment development programs, NIDA strives to mitigate the devastating impact of drugs upon individuals, families, and communities. Their vast database of information and resources provides valuable insights into the science of addiction, available treatments, and approaches for prevention.

  • NIDA's research efforts encompass a wide range of substances, from opioids to stimulants and cannabis.
  • ,Additionally NIDA collaborates with researchers, policymakers, and healthcare professionals to translate scientific findings into effective policies and interventions.
  • The institute also supports training programs for healthcare providers, enhancing their ability to diagnose, treat, and address substance use disorders.
